Family of Humanity, Inc. awarded a $5000 corporate grant from Jarden Consumer Solutions to support youth literacy.

On Monday, August 31, 2009 Jarden Consumer Solutions (JCS) awarded Family of Humanity, Inc. (FOH) with a corporate grant of $5000 to support the literacy component of the H.U.G Program. The Jarden Corporation is a leading provider of niche consumer products used in and around the home.
Jarden’s Miami and Boca Raton offices continue to be involved in the local community by finding innovative ways to be of service to those in need. This year the staff donated a portion of their salary to be put in a fund designated for community outreach programs of which FOH was one.

The Teen Development & Growth Program Community Service Project
The teens from the Teen Development and Growth Program of Family of Humanity, Inc. (FOH) visited the Ronald McDonald House (RMH) on Saturday, September 12 and presented them with a hand made “Hope Quilt” and plaque for the families who reside at the House.
The Ronald McDonald House located at 15 SE 15th Street Ft. Lauderdale, FL 33316 provides a “home-away-from home,” being a temporary lodging facility for the families of seriously ill children receiving treatment at a nearby hospital. At the RMH families can prepare meals, do laundry, and meet with other families in similar situations helping them get through one of the most difficult time of their lives.
The U.S. Century Bank in Hollywood sponsored the “HOPE” Quilt project with a generous donation of $1000 which provided art materials, supplies and an educator to complete the quilt. Gerardo Mederos, Vice President and Branch Manager of the Hollywood Branch as well as Treasurer of the FOH Board presented a plaque to Stacie Davis, Weekend Manager at RMH as a token of appreciation and goodwill for the partnership fostered between RMH and FOH. The hand crafted quilt and plaque is now on display for all the families in the family room at the RMH.
